Sie können Benutzern erlauben, ein Steuerelement in Visual Basic-Anwendung zu entfernen, nachdem es nicht mehr sinnvoll mit der Control-Klasse . Diese Klasse definiert die Basisklasse für Steuerelemente in Ihrer VB-Anwendung. Sobald Sie erkennen das Steuerelement entfernt mit dem " Enthält "-Methode werden , entfernen Sie sie , indem Sie die Schaltfläche "Entfernen "-Methode. Denken Sie daran, dass, wenn Sie ein Steuerelement aus der Kontrolle Sammlung entfernen, werden alle nachfolgenden Kontrollen in Position in der Auflistung verschoben. Anleitung
1
Starten Sie Microsoft Visual Basic Express, klicken Sie auf " Neues Projekt ... " auf der linken Seite des Bildschirms und doppelklicken Sie auf "Windows Forms-Anwendung ", um ein neues Projekt zu starten.
2
Doppelklicken Sie auf " ListBox " auf der Toolbox Bereich , um eine neue Listenfeld-Steuerelement hinzuzufügen. Fügen Sie eine Schaltfläche durch Doppelklick auf "Button " auf der Toolbox.
3
Doppelklicken Sie auf die Schaltfläche, um einen Click-Ereignis zu erstellen. Fügen Sie den folgenden Code, um das Listenfeld-Steuerelement aus dem Formular zu entfernen, wenn die Schaltfläche geklickt wird :
Wenn Me.Controls.Contains ( ListBox1 ) Dann
Me.Controls.Remove ( ListBox1 )
End If
4
Presse "F5" , um das Programm zu starten und klicken Sie auf " Button1 ", um das Listenfeld-Steuerelement zu entfernen.